pyrenomycete on dead parts of foliose liverwort from Norway
Lothar Krieglsteiner, 18-08-2025 15:07
Lothar Krieglsteiner.. 20.7.25, in subarctic habital. 
The liverwort is introduced here, unfortunately without answer:

https://nafoku.de/forum/202507_0118_0001.htm
https://nafoku.de/forum/202507_0118_0002.htm
https://nafoku.de/forum/202507_0118_0003.htm

The ascus porus is strikingly blue in Baral and stays so - in Melzer (after KOH) it is reacting blue first also but hen the color is vanishing rapidly (the chloral hydrate is likely arriving later than the iodine and supresses the freaction then). 
The spores are longitudinally and transversely septate, they vary strongly in size between 25-40/9-14 µm. 

Who can provide me with a hint?
The bluing porus might point to Xylariales (?).

Georges Greiff, 19-08-2025 13:31
Re : pyrenomycete on dead parts of foliose liverwort from Norway
Hi Lothar,

I think it is a Protothelenella species. Fits very well.
